Coke Truck Overturned, Soda Bottles Smashed On Highway Shoulder
posted (July 15, 2016)
If you were traveling on the Phillip Goldson Highway heading into Belize City this morning, you most definitely encountered a serious traffic jam during the rush hour. That's because a Bowen and Bowen Truck ended up overturned at around mile 8.

It was loaded with countless crates of soft drinks which ended up strewn and shattered on the side of the road. When we arrived on the scene, the Bowen employees were trying to salvage what they could.

Today, Ladyville told us what they've learnt about the cause of the accident:

Sgt. Leon Hewlett - Sergeant In Charge, Ladyville Police
"Information was received at the Ladyville police station of an accident on mile 8 on the Philip Goldson highway. Based on that information received, Ladyville police visited the scene where upon the arrival they observed a white international brand truck bearing license plate number A3521 overturned on the left hand side of the highway while traveling toward Belize City. Investigation further reveal that between those hours, 25 year old Henry Williams, Belizean truck driver of Bowen & Bowen Ltd, was driving the said truck on the direction of Ladyville towards Belize City. Upon reaching mile 8, he lost control of the truck which caused him to overturn. As a result of that accident, Mr. Williams received mild injuries to the left arm, not life threatening. Accompanying him at the time inside of the truck was Angel Vargas who fortunately did not receive any injuries. From our investigation it appears that speeding might have been a contributory factor, investigation is still ongoing and as soon as information becomes readily available we will have that given to you."

On the scene this morning, we met one employee who told us that the upper management would be addressing the issue with the media. But, up until news, no official information had been released from Bowen and Bowen on the loss of thousands of dollars in product.
